dracut icon indicating copy to clipboard operation
dracut copied to clipboard

fix(systemd-pcrphase): rename systemd-pcrphase binary to systemd-pcrextend

Open aafeijoo-suse opened this issue 2 years ago • 5 comments

The systemd-pcrphase binary has been renamed to systemd-pcrextend since https://github.com/systemd/systemd/commit/32295fa0

This patch will be necessary for systemd-v255.

Checklist

  • [ ] I have tested it locally
  • [ ] I have reviewed and updated any documentation if relevant
  • [ ] I am providing new code and test(s) for it

aafeijoo-suse avatar Sep 26 '23 06:09 aafeijoo-suse

Wouldn't this break compatibility with older systemd?

lnykryn avatar Dec 11 '23 08:12 lnykryn

Wouldn't this break compatibility with older systemd?

yep. #2586 should provide compatibility for both, albeit requiring the dracut invocation to use systemd-pcrextend name

ferringb avatar Dec 12 '23 00:12 ferringb

Wouldn't this break compatibility with older systemd?

Yes, systemd-pcrphase was introduced in systemd-v252. I thought that our current upstream policy was to support only the latest version of other upstream dependencies, otherwise this is unmanageable.

aafeijoo-suse avatar Dec 12 '23 07:12 aafeijoo-suse

This issue is being marked as stale because it has not had any recent activity. It will be closed if no further activity occurs. If this is still an issue in the latest release of Dracut and you would like to keep it open please comment on this issue within the next 7 days. Thank you for your contributions.

stale[bot] avatar Mar 13 '24 06:03 stale[bot]

This issue is being marked as stale because it has not had any recent activity. It will be closed if no further activity occurs. If this is still an issue in the latest release of Dracut and you would like to keep it open please comment on this issue within the next 7 days. Thank you for your contributions.

stale[bot] avatar Apr 22 '24 06:04 stale[bot]